> Author talks about 4k video, but AI tells me that for "4K production mastering (ProRes 422 HQ, 4:2:2, 10-bit)" the rate is under 2Gbps. That'd be the rate for 1 stream at 1x playback. Multiple streams because of overlays/crossfades/etc... along with playback at >1x (such as during rendering in particular) will change that significantly. | ||||||||
